Jupiter enters Gemini May 25-June 8th, 2025

Jupiter is the planet of gain and expansion and wherever it goes in your chart is where you will see the greatest gain and luck.

Jupiter is called ‘the greater benefic’ and Venus is the ‘lesser benefic.’ Gemini is ruled by Mercury, the planet of communication, commerce and young people. Our luck during this transit will come in the form of ideas, communication, travel, education and it will be a great time for publishing, speaking, writing, singing and the like. It will necessitate a broad minded approach and you may want to leave your comfort zone behind when it comes to new ideas.  The last time Jupiter was in this sign was June 11, 2012-June 26, 2013.

Jupiter in Gemini is considered to be debilitated in the sign of Gemini which simply means it is not as comfortable in this sign as others. Nevertheless, we can expect gain and expansion wherever it falls in your chart.

Jupiter in Gemini is chatty, expansive, optimistic, broad minded, and prone toward big ideas, plans and education.

 Where and how it helps you depends not only on where it falls in your chart but the aspects it makes to other planets. Let’s take a look at what Jupiter will do over the next year;

May 2nd, Pluto retrogrades until October 12th

Pluto retrograde is not anything like Mercury retrograde when things can go off the rails, and many times may go unnoticed unless it is making a significant aspect in your own personal chart. Pluto retrogrades every year for approximately half of the year and its affects occur on a very subtle level.

This year Pluto will retrograde back into Capricorn one more time from September 3rd-November 19th. At this point it will return to Aquarius for the next 20 years! We have been dealing with Pluto in Capricorn since 2008. Pluto’s square to Uranus kicked off the worldwide banking crisis.

To say Pluto in this sign has been difficult in the world is an understatement. In 2020 when Pluto was conjunct Saturn we experienced the worldwide spread of Covid.

During Pluto’s two and a half month final swing it will remain at 29 degrees of Capricorn and the 29th degree is considered critical. We are wrapping up old things in preparation for something new but this often brings a crisis.

Mercury turns retrograde 3 or 4 times a year, and generally has a bad name.  To an extent this is perfectly understandable, as retrograde Mercury is the planet that causes delays, glitches, breakdowns in computers and equipment, relationships, slowdowns and brings hidden factors to the surface. Plans can be put on hold, miscommunication can occur, relationships can end or change, and any kind of machinery can break down at the most inopportune moment.

When planets retrograde, their effects on humans are different than when in direct motion. Thinking is deeper, situations often appear to go underground for a time, or change altogether, and sometimes our focus shifts.

The first phase of retrograde Mercury is the pre-retrograde shadow period which began March 19th. This period is when Mercurial energy starts to shift and is typically noticeable in terms of being forgetful.

The second phase of retrograde Mercury is the stationary retrograde period, when Mercury starts to shift into apparent backward motion. This happens April 1-3rd, when Mercury begins its retrograde. This is when most glitches start to become evident, and thinking may become extra foggy. Stay alert!

Mercury continues to retrograde through April 25th, when it turns stationary direct for the next several days. This is the second period when glitches, breakdowns and changes in direction may well occur. It can get worse before it gets better!

Mercury begins to move forward again on April 27th, but remains in the post direct shadow phase phase until May 13th. Mercurial energy does not pick up its normal pace until completion of the second shadow period.
